Unveiling the Wilderness: Explore Bhutan’s Breathtaking Biodiversity at the Manas Winter Fest

Thimphu, Thimphu, Bhutan, 3rd Feb 2025, – Bhutan, a biodiversity hotspot, offers an incredible wildlife safari experience in its protected national parks and sanctuaries. Bhutan tours not only include cultural, festival or adventure but offers the variety of Safari in the package. From the rare Bengal tiger, snow leopard, and red panda to the iconic Takin, Bhutan’s national animal, the kingdom is home to diverse flora and fauna. Explore Royal Manas National Park, Jigme Dorji National Park, and Phibsoo Wildlife Sanctuary, where lush forests, alpine meadows, and rivers create a perfect habitat for exotic wildlife. Birdwatchers can spot black-necked cranes and hornbills in their natural surroundings. A Bhutan wildlife safari promises an unforgettable encounter with nature, untouched and thriving in the Land of the Thunder Dragon. Starting this year Panbang have initiated new festival for guest to explore the authentic wildlife in Panbang. This is new in the wildlife Safari.

Discover the Vibrant Spirit of Panbang at the Manas Winter Fest

If you are seeking an unforgettable adventure filled with culture, breath-taking landscapes, and thrilling activities, look no further than the Manas Winter Fest in Panbang. This annual event, held on the 22nd and 23rd of February, is a celebration of the region’s rich heritage, stunning natural beauty, and vibrant local community. It promises a remarkable experience for adventure seekers, cultural enthusiasts, nature lovers, and travellers seeking an off-the-beaten-path destination.

A Cultural Extravaganza and Talent Showcase

One of the festival’s highlights is the variety of cultural performances that immerse visitors in the unique traditions of Panbang. Be captivated by mesmerizing traditional shows and cheer on local youth as they participate in an open talent hunt. The vibrant energy and authentic cultural expressions will leave you with memories to cherish.

Thrilling Adventure Activities

Adventure seekers will find plenty to excite them at the Manas Winter Fest. Visitors can:

  • White-water Rafting: Navigate the exhilarating rapids of the Manas River.
  • Fly Fishing: Try your hand at catching some of the region’s finest fish.
  • Bird Watching: Marvel at the diverse bird species that inhabit the lush surroundings.
  • Hiking the Eco-Trail: Embark on a scenic trek through the pristine landscapes of Manas, offering unparalleled views and a chance to connect with nature.

Sightseeing Adventures

Explore the remarkable sights that make Panbang a hidden gem:

  • Twin Waterfalls: Be awed by the beauty and power of these natural wonders.
  • Tingbu Raja Archaeological Site: Step back in time and discover the rich history of the region.
  • Tiger Center: Gain insight into the conservation efforts dedicated to protecting the majestic tiger population.
  • Nishioka Suspension Bridge: Experience the thrill of walking across this iconic structure while enjoying stunning views of the landscape.

Easy Steps to Book a Bhutan Tour

Booking a trip to Bhutan is simple, Here’s a step-by-step guide:

Step 1: Choose Your Travel Dates

  • The best times to visit Bhutan are spring (March-May) and autumn (September-November) for festivals and pleasant weather.
  • If you prefer fewer crowds, consider winter (December-February) or summer (June-August). Perfect for Panbang Festival.

Step 2: Select a Licensed Tour Operator

  • Bhutan requires all tourists (except Indian, Bangladeshi, and Maldivian citizens) to book through an authorized Bhutanese tour operator or their international partners.
  • You can find a list of licensed tour operators on the official Tourism Council of Bhutan website.
  • Compare different tour packages based on your preferences (cultural tours, trekking, luxury, adventure, etc.).

Step 3: Confirm Your Itinerary and Costs

  • Standard tours include accommodation, meals, transport, a guide, and entry fees.
  • A Sustainable Development Fee (SDF) is required:
    • $100 per person per night for most tourists.
    • Lower SDF rates apply for Indian visitors.
  • Discuss and customize your itinerary with the tour operator.

Step 4: Book Your Flights

  • Bhutan’s only international airport is Paro International Airport (PBH).
  • Flights to Bhutan are operated by Druk Air and Bhutan Airlines, flying from cities like Bangkok, Delhi, Kathmandu, and Singapore.

Step 5: Apply for a Bhutan Visa

  • We will apply for your visa once you confirm your booking and make the payment.
  • Required documents:
    • Passport (valid for at least 6 months)
    • Passport-size photo
  • The visa approval usually takes 5–7 days, and you’ll receive an e-visa via email.

Step 6: Pack for Your Trip

  • Pack based on the season and activities (warm clothing for winter, rain gear for monsoon, comfortable trekking shoes, etc.).
  • Bhutanese culture is modest—carry conservative clothing for temple visits.

Step 7: Arrive and Enjoy Bhutan

  • Upon arrival at Paro Airport, your tour guide will meet you and handle everything, including transport and sightseeing.
  • Relax and experience Bhutan’s breathtaking landscapes, monasteries, and unique culture!

Bonus Tip:

Book your Bhutan tour at least 1-2 months in advance, especially if traveling during peak festival seasons.

Genie Trailblazer Program by Agibot Empowers Embodied Intelligence Technology

Published

on

Shanghai, China, 17th Oct 2025 — Recently, Agibot officially launched the “Genie Trailblazer Global Recruitment Program”, aiming to invite top researchers worldwide to collaboratively define and create artificial intelligence capable of perceiving, reasoning, and emotionally engaging with the physical world.

This initiative provides a platform for scientific collaboration, focusing on three core research directions: general-purpose embodied intelligence models, embodied world models, and advanced teleoperation. Agibot warmly welcomes researchers from diverse backgrounds, including multimodal modeling, reinforcement learning, robotics, and world model experts, as long as they are passionate about shaping the future of embodied intelligence.

Moreover, Agibot offers robust support and resources to participating researchers. During the project period, researchers will receive free access to Agibot’s general-purpose embodied intelligence robot, Genie G1, enabling them to conduct data collection, model testing, and iterative development using this advanced physical platform to accelerate the realization of their ideas. Additionally, Agibot provides meticulously annotated real-world datasets and a high-fidelity digital twin environment, offering critical support to tackle the core challenges of sim-to-real transfer.

On the technical front, the high-performance robot platform features agile mobility and dexterous manipulation capabilities, integrated with an end-to-end data closed-loop system that spans the entire pipeline—from data collection and simulation-based training to real-world deployment. Researchers can deploy general-purpose embodied models on Agibot’s platform for end-to-end training and testing in real environments. They can also leverage AgiBot World, AgiBot Digital World, and specialized embodied-scenario datasets to validate their models’ understanding of physical laws, thereby endowing robots with planning and “imagination” capabilities.

To incentivize participation, Agibot has established a cash prize pool totaling RMB 1 million. Teams selected for the program and delivering outstanding results will be awarded the“GT-Star”. Exceptional developers will also gain direct access to internship opportunities and fast-track recruitment pathways at Agibot.

Agibot believes that the future of intelligence begins with embodiment. This initiative is expected to ignite global researchers’ innovative potential and collectively advance the frontier of embodied intelligence technologies.

New Active Hyperspectral System From Ohio State University Researchers Enables Precise Spectral Sensing in Complete Darkness

Published

on

Columbus, United States, 17th Oct 2025 – A study in the journal Sensors unveils an affordable and efficient system that captures high-fidelity spectral data in low-light and underground environments, opening new possibilities for geology, agriculture, and manufacturing.

A research team from The Ohio State University has developed an active hyperspectral imaging system capable of capturing precise spectral data in the complete absence of light. The design, constructed from low-cost commercial components, presents an accessible and efficient alternative to traditional technologies.

The breakthrough, detailed in the peer-reviewed journal Sensors, introduces a compact and energy-efficient prototype poised to transform material analysis in environments previously considered inaccessible for high-fidelity spectral sensing.


Traditional hyperspectral imaging systems identify materials by analyzing their special spectral “fingerprints” across hundreds of wavelength bands. However, these passive systems are fundamentally dependent on ambient light and often require costly, complex optical components, restricting their use in dark or confined settings such as underground tunnels, mines, or even for quality control in dimly lit industrial facilities.
The Ohio State team’s special approach overcomes these limitations by replacing passive detection with a programmable array of 76 single-wavelength LEDs synchronized with a full-spectrum camera. This active illumination method allows the system to generate its own light source, ensuring high-quality spectral data acquisition regardless of external lighting conditions.


“Our goal was to make hyperspectral imaging more efficient, accessible, and usable in real-world settings — not just in laboratories,” said Dr. Rongjun Qin, a professor in the Department of Civil, Environmental and Geodetic Engineering and the corresponding author of the study. “This system allows us to take the lab to the field, wherever that field may be.”

To validate its performance, the team tested the prototype on a variety of samples, including fruits, plant leaves, and rock specimens, under challenging low-light conditions. The results demonstrated a remarkable capability to distinguish subtle spectral changes—such as variations in fruit freshness or mineral composition—that are invisible to standard RGB cameras. A machine learning analysis of the captured data achieved a classification accuracy of up to 90%, a significant improvement over the 70% accuracy obtained with conventional imaging under similar conditions.


Beyond its high accuracy, the system offers substantial gains in efficiency. The prototype reduced the full-image acquisition time from 20 seconds to under 2.5 seconds. By eliminating the need for complex filters and bulky external lighting setups, the design is not only more cost-effective but also highly portable and consumes less power. Its lightweight form factor is suitable for portable field use or integration with drone-based platforms, enabling faster and more sustainable field operations.

A central theme of the research is the democratization of advanced sensing technology. Built entirely from commercially available, or “off-the-shelf,” components, the system drastically lowers the financial barrier for smaller laboratories and research institutions.

“All of the components are low-cost and readily available. This means laboratories and universities worldwide can adapt our design with minimal resources,” stated Yang Tang, a Ph.D. student and the study’s lead author. “We believe this will empower a wider scientific community and open up new opportunities for AI-driven material analysis and education in optical sensing.”

The potential applications for this technology are extensive and cross-sectoral. In geological exploration and mining, it can operate in dark, subterranean environments without the need for expensive and cumbersome lighting equipment. In agriculture and food safety, it offers a reliable method for monitoring crop health or detecting contamination. For manufacturing and environmental monitoring, it provides consistent and repeatable data under any lighting condition, enhancing quality control and compliance.


The research team plans to continue refining the system by enhancing its capture speed, increasing spectral resolution, and further integrating the hardware into a fully portable and automated imaging platform. “We envision a future where hyperspectral imaging becomes as routine as taking a photograph — efficient, affordable, and universally accessible,” added Dr. Qin.

About the Study

 The full study, titled “An Active Hyperspectral Imager by a Programmable LED Array and a Full-Spectrum Camera,” is published in Sensors. It can be accessed at the following DOI: https://doi.org/10.3390/s23031437

Espregnol to Expand Global Offline Channels via Partnerships with Medical and Pharmacy Networks

Published

on

South Korea, 17th Oct 2025 – Pre-conception (pregnancy-prep) wellness formula Espregnol announced that, following a nationwide sell-out of its 5th production run in the Republic of Korea, it has begun manufacturing the 6th batch with a renewed premium formula. In line with this, the company stated it is preparing to expand global offline distribution by building partnerships with local OB/GYN clinics and pharmacy networks.

According to the company, surging interest in EsPregnol has been accompanied by growing demand for women’s circulation & balance management (Balanced Vital Sync. Flow), leading to increased inquiries from potential overseas partners. 

While maintaining multi-language labeling and allergen disclosures compliant with each country’s regulations, as well as bottle-level batch QR traceability (showing summaries of key quality tests such as heavy metals and microbiological counts), EsPregnol is discussing the co-distribution of a standardized counseling sheet for physicians and pharmacists at pharmacy counters (including full ingredient lists and recommended 2–3-hour co-administration intervals).

At the initial stage, the roadmap under review includes pilot listings with pharmacy chains, tests in airport/drugstore channels, and integration with a 24/7 international Adverse Event Reporting (AER) system, to be rolled out sequentially.

An EsPregnol spokesperson said, “Having sold out our 5th run domestically and commenced premium-renewal 6th production, we will pursue both stable supply and standardized offline counseling. Through collaborations with medical and pharmacy networks, we are preparing information delivery and distribution aligned with each country’s standards.”
